Bipartisan passions run high in ArmeniaJune 29, 2009 - 23:58 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- "To conduct black PR and accuse Zaruhi Postanjyan of national treason, the authorities used their levers in Strasburg. Yet, they've forgotten that they are traitors themselves," RA NA MP Stepan Safaryan told a news conference on Monday. Stefan Safaryan presented a proof of the fact that in 2008 David Harutyunyan and Avet Adonts, representatives of RA Republican and Prosperous Armenia Parties, signed a document specifying that "armed conflict in Azeri Nagorno-Karabakh region hinders the development of Azerbaijan". The document bore signatures of a number of RA Delegation representatives.
